Japan's Yuuji Nakata finished 2-2 in the 10-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Japan's Yuuji Nakata lost 9-1 to Japan's Juon Ishimura, droppimg another game, 7-3 to Japan's Tsuyoshi Sukekawa where Japan's Yuuji Nakata responded with a 11-2 win over Japan's Yasuhiro Sano. Japan's Yuuji Nakata won 7-3 against Japan's Toshiaki Takahashi in their final qualifying round match.
Japan's Yuuji Nakata earned 0.731 world rankings points for their preliminary round wins, moving up 138 spots the World Ranking Standings into 391st place overall with 0.731 total points. Japan's Yuuji Nakata ranks 321st over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 0.731 points earned so far this season.
